3.配置VLAN,并实现VLAN间的通信;继续进行相应的路由配置,实现全网通。(S2和S3上不做任何配置,认为已配置好即可)
时间: 2024-12-17 08:25:34 浏览: 4
eNSP实验5-2-单臂路由实现VLAN间通信 -硬件实验
在配置虚拟局域网(VLAN)时,我们通常将物理网络分割成多个逻辑子网,每个子网代表一个独立的广播域。首先,你需要在交换机(比如S1和S2)上划分VLAN,这可以通过设置端口属性来指定某个端口属于哪个VLAN。例如:
```
Switch# configure terminal
Switch(config)# vlan add VLAN_ID
Switch(config-vlan)# name VLAN_NAME
Switch(config-vlan)# exit
Switch(config)# interface FastEthernet_0/1
Switch(config-if)# switchport mode access
Switch(config-if)# switchport access vlan VLAN_ID
```
然后,为了让VLAN间能通信,需要配置二层互联,通常是通过Trunk链路或者VLAN trunk,允许不同VLAN的数据帧通过。此外,如果需要三层通信,还需要在路由器(比如S1)上创建VLAN接口并配置相应的IP地址:
```
Router(config)# interface GigabitEthernet0/1
Router(config-if)# no shutdown
Router(config-if)# switchport hybrid pvid VLAN_ID
Router(config-if)# encapsulation dot1q trunk native VLAN_ID
Router(config-if)# ip address IP_ADDRESS SUBNET_MASK
```
接着,配置路由,使得VLAN内的主机能够通过默认网关访问其他VLAN。例如,在S1路由器上添加一条静态路由或者动态路由协议(如OSPF)来宣告VLAN接口的可达性:
```
Router(config)# ip route DEFAULT_GATEWAY_IP VLAN_INTERFACE_IP
```
完成以上配置后,S1和S2的设备就可以在各自的VLAN内互相通信,同时也能通过路由器实现VLAN间的跨域通信。
阅读全文